The photo you see below is THE DESTROYER!
As per my source, THE DESTROYER is sent to earth by Loki to destroy Thor. It stands at about 9 feet tall.
TheDestroyer is an enchanted suit of armor forged by Odin, and when itfirst appeared it was hinted that the Destroyer had been created as aweapon to face some dark menace from the stars. The Destroyer is usedby Thor's arch-foe Loki on several occasions, and each time hasactually come close to killing Thor.
The film follows the mightyThor (Chris Hemsworth), a powerful but arrogant warrior whose recklessactions reignite an ancient war. Thor is cast down to Earth by hisfather Odin (Anthony Hopkins) and is forced to live among humans. Abeautiful young scientist, Jane Foster (Natalie Portman), has aprofound effect on Thor, as she ultimately becomes his first love. It’swhile here on Earth that Thor learns what it takes to be a true herowhen the most dangerous villain of his world sends the darkest forcesof Asgard to invade Earth.
